Memo to the office manager — quick heads-up on the chess paperwork. The signed score sheets from the Northgate regional final are sitting in the locked drawer by the kettle, sorted by round. The league secretary at Marrowfield needs the originals before Friday to certify the results, so we're sending them by courier rather than internal post. One condition from the arbiter applies to the hand-over, noted directly below.

dispatch memo: the lamwyn fenwyn courier leaves the wenir ledger at gate 7175 under passcode 822969

Q: Why do entries in the Brindlewatch audit-log viewer sometimes appear out of order? A: Ingestion is eventually consistent across regions, so events can land up to five minutes late; the viewer sorts by event time, not arrival time, which causes brief reshuffling. This is expected and not data loss. The consistency model is explained fully on this internal page.

runbook for tajep-yahig: https://artifactory.lumictech.corp/repo

## Releases

Cutting a release of QueueSprout (our queue-depth autoscaler) is pretty painless: bump the version in `scaler.toml`, run `make package`, and tag the commit. The pipeline signs the tarball automatically, but if you're releasing from a laptop (please don't, unless CI is down), you'll need to sign manually with the key below.

release key, fahaf-bajof: bky3_Xam